In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: bpf: Drop task_to_inode and inet_conn_established from lsm sleepable hooks bpf_lsm_task_to_inode() is called under rcu_read_lock() and bpf_lsm_inet_conn_established() is called from softirq context, so neither hook can be used by sleepable LSM programs.Enginsight
